Basic Safety Items

Basic safety items form the core of urban survival gear. These tools protect you from harm and help you manage emergencies. Every urban survivor should carry essential safety equipment. It ensures readiness for unexpected situations.

Personal Protection Tools

Personal protection tools keep you safe in risky situations. Items like pepper spray, a whistle, or a small flashlight can deter threats. A sturdy multi-tool also helps with self-defense and practical tasks. Choose compact, easy-to-carry tools for quick access.

First Aid Essentials

First aid essentials treat injuries and prevent infections. Basic supplies include bandages, antiseptic wipes, and pain relief medication. Carry items like adhesive tape and scissors for wound care. Keep these supplies in a small, organized kit for emergencies.

Emergency Lighting

Emergency lighting guides you in the dark and signals for help. A reliable flashlight or headlamp is crucial. Choose LED lights for bright, long-lasting illumination. Extra batteries or a rechargeable option keep your light ready to use.

Communication Devices

Communication devices are crucial for urban survival. They keep you connected and informed during emergencies. Reliable communication helps you find help or warn others quickly. Choosing the right gear can make a big difference in critical moments.

Portable Chargers And Power Banks

Portable chargers and power banks keep your devices powered. They are small and easy to carry. In a power outage, these devices keep your phone alive. Choose power banks with high capacity for longer use. Always carry one fully charged for emergencies.

Two-way Radios

Two-way radios offer instant communication without cell networks. They work well in crowded or signal-poor areas. These radios are simple to use and reliable. They help you stay in touch with family or group members. Pick radios with good range and clear sound.

Emergency Alert Apps

Emergency alert apps send real-time warnings and updates. They provide alerts about weather, crime, or accidents nearby. Some apps allow you to send your location to trusted contacts. Keep these apps installed and updated on your phone. They improve your awareness and safety in the city.

Navigation Tools

Navigation tools are essential for urban survival. They help you find your way in crowded cities and unfamiliar places. Knowing your location is key during emergencies or power outages. A good mix of tools ensures you stay on track.

Physical Maps

Physical maps do not need batteries or signals. They show streets, landmarks, and important places clearly. Keep a paper map in your bag for easy access. Practice reading maps to improve your skills before an emergency.

Gps Devices

GPS devices use satellites to give exact locations. They work well in cities but need power and signal. Choose a compact GPS with long battery life. Carry extra batteries or a power bank to stay ready.

Compass Use In Urban Areas

A compass shows directions without power or signals. It helps when streets are confusing or blocked. Learn to use a compass with a map for better navigation. Knowing north, south, east, and west guides you safely.

Food And Water Supplies

Food and water are the basics for urban survival. Without them, staying safe and healthy is tough. Preparing a good supply is essential. It helps you stay strong during emergencies. This section covers key items you need for food and water.

Portable Water Filters

Clean water is not always available. Carry a portable water filter to make water safe. These filters remove dirt, bacteria, and harmful germs. They are small and easy to carry. Perfect for use in cities after disasters. Use them with rivers, taps, or any water source.

Non-perishable Snacks

Non-perishable snacks last long without refrigeration. Choose items like nuts, dried fruits, and energy bars. They provide quick energy and nutrients. Easy to store in backpacks or emergency kits. Great for times when cooking is not possible.

Water Storage Solutions

Storing clean water is critical. Use strong bottles, jugs, or collapsible containers. Keep enough water for at least three days. Store water in a cool, dark place. Regularly check and replace stored water to keep it fresh.

Multi-functional Tools

Multi-functional tools are essential for urban survival. They save space and offer many uses in one device. Carrying these tools prepares you for unexpected challenges in the city. They help with tasks like cutting, fixing, and starting fires. Choosing the right tools makes your survival kit more effective.

Pocket Knives And Multi-tools

Pocket knives are compact and sharp. They cut ropes, open packages, and prepare food. Multi-tools include pliers, screwdrivers, and blades in one unit. They handle repairs and small jobs quickly. A good multi-tool fits easily in your pocket or bag.

Duct Tape And Repair Kits

Duct tape is strong and sticky. It fixes tears, holds items together, and even seals leaks. Repair kits may include patches, glue, and small tools. These kits help you fix clothes, gear, or other equipment fast. Carry a small roll of duct tape for many repairs.

Fire Starters

Fire starters help create fire without matches. They work in wet and windy conditions. Fire makes warmth, cooks food, and signals for help. Carry compact fire starters like ferro rods or waterproof matches. They are lightweight and easy to use.

Clothing And Shelter

Clothing and shelter are essential for urban survival. They protect you from harsh weather and help maintain your body temperature. Proper gear can prevent illness and keep you comfortable during emergencies. Choosing the right items ensures you stay safe and prepared.

Weather-appropriate Apparel

Select clothing that suits the climate you face daily. Breathable fabrics work well in hot weather. Waterproof jackets and pants protect against rain and wind. Layering helps adjust to changing temperatures. Always carry extra socks and gloves for cold nights.

Compact Shelter Options

Compact shelters are easy to carry and set up quickly. Look for lightweight tents or tarp systems. They shield you from rain and provide privacy. Small shelters fit into backpacks without adding bulk. Choose shelters with durable materials for long use.

Thermal Blankets

Thermal blankets save heat and block wind effectively. They are small, light, and easy to pack. Use them to stay warm during cold nights or sudden weather changes. Reflective surfaces help keep your body heat inside. Carry at least one blanket in your survival kit.

Personal Documentation And Money

Personal documentation and money are vital in any urban survival kit. They help prove your identity and allow you to access essential services. Having the right documents and cash can make a big difference during emergencies.

Keeping these items safe and accessible is crucial. Prepare for situations where digital systems might fail. Carry a mix of physical and digital payment options. Store important papers securely but within reach.

Emergency Identification

Always carry a form of ID such as a driver’s license or passport. These prove who you are in emergencies. Include copies of medical information and emergency contacts. Wear a medical alert bracelet if needed. Keep IDs in a waterproof pouch to protect them.

Cash And Digital Payments

Cash is king when electronic payments fail. Carry small bills for easy transactions. Avoid relying only on cards or mobile apps. Keep some coins for vending machines or small purchases. Use prepaid cards as a backup payment method.

Secure Document Storage

Store important papers in a compact, waterproof case. Use a fireproof pouch for extra protection. Organize documents like birth certificates, insurance, and legal papers. Backup digital copies on an encrypted USB drive. Keep these items in a secure but accessible place.

Transportation And Mobility Aids

Transportation and mobility aids are vital for urban survival. They help you move quickly and safely during emergencies. Keeping essential gear ready ensures you avoid delays and stay mobile. Choosing the right tools improves your chances of reaching safety or supplies.

Bicycle Repair Kits

Bicycles are a reliable way to travel in cities. A small repair kit can fix common problems fast. Include tire levers, patches, and a mini pump. Wrenches and screwdrivers help tighten loose parts. Compact kits fit easily in backpacks or bike bags.

Portable Inflators

Flat tires stop movement and waste valuable time. Portable inflators quickly refill tires on the go. Battery-powered models work without manual effort. Choose lightweight and quiet designs. Keep an inflator handy for emergencies or long trips.

Comfortable Footwear

Good shoes protect your feet and reduce fatigue. Choose sturdy, comfortable footwear for walking or running. Waterproof and breathable materials suit various weather conditions. Proper shoes prevent injuries and make long distances easier. Always have reliable footwear ready for quick escapes.
